Gods Unchained: Blockchain Gaming Meets Competitive Card Play
Gods Unchained is a free-to-play, trading card game built on the Ethereum blockchain (with transactions processed via Immutable X for zero gas fees). Developed by Immutable, it draws clear inspiration from Hearthstone but adds a crucial twist: every card you earn is a real NFT that you own and can sell on the open market.
How Gods Unchained Works
Players construct decks from six gods — each representing a different domain with its own playstyle and card pool. You battle opponents in ranked or casual matches. As you win games, you accumulate Flux, which you use to forge duplicate cards into NFTs that can be traded or sold.
This forge mechanic is clever: cards start as off-chain copies with no monetary value, and only through consistent play do they become tradeable NFTs. It prevents the game from being flooded with low-effort NFT speculation while rewarding genuine players.
Getting Started for Free
One of Gods Unchained's strongest features is its genuinely free entry point. New players receive a starter deck of basic cards and can build their collection through:
- Winning weekend ranked events to earn card packs
- Completing daily and weekly quests
- Climbing ranked modes to unlock reward tiers
- Purchasing card packs from the in-game store or marketplace
You don't need to spend a single dollar to start playing and earning — though investing in strong cards will accelerate your progress.
The GODS Token
GODS is the native utility token of Gods Unchained. It's used for:
- Forging cards into NFTs
- Purchasing premium card packs
- Staking for passive rewards
- Participating in governance decisions
GODS is earned through gameplay and available on major exchanges. Its value fluctuates with the broader crypto market, so earnings vary accordingly.
